I know this was 5 years ago, but would you still recommend sway bar install? Any problems? Does it get in the way when having to change other things out like tie rods?
@TheMinuteMasters
@TheMinuteMasters 7 месяцев назад
After living with the sway bar and understanding how the twin I beam suspension works, I wouldn’t recommend a front sway bar. A rear sway bar would make more sense with controlling loads. The sway bar doesn’t physically get in the at with making other repairs like tie rods.

looking at a 94 f150 6 inch lift on 33s. was told it had play in the steering. will a new stabilizer bar fix that he said i need a new stabilizer bar but wanna make sure before i buy it
@TheMinuteMasters
@TheMinuteMasters 5 лет назад
Dan Ellsworth Gotcha. A sway bar flattens out the steering. Do you have excessive body roll or is there a lot of play in the actual steering?
@danellsworth5872
@danellsworth5872 5 лет назад
@@TheMinuteMasters theres not alot of play maybe a inch at the most.
@TheMinuteMasters
@TheMinuteMasters 5 лет назад
Dan Ellsworth I would try tighten the steering on top of the steering box first. Only tighten it a 1/4 turn at a time. I’m told over tightening it can make the steering too tight and wear the gears out prematurely. Otherwise, make sure all your steering components are in good working order, that includes the ball joints. I say go for a seat bar because it just makes “spirited” driving that much more fun.
